Ingredients for Ham and Cheese Almond Flour Breakfast Biscuits (Keto)

Gather these simple ingredients – I promise you probably have most in your kitchen already! The key is using freshly shredded cheese (none of that pre-shredded stuff with anti-caking powder) and good-quality diced ham for the best flavor. Here’s what you’ll need:

  • 2 cups almond flour – This is your flour substitute, so make sure it’s fine-ground
  • 1/2 cup shredded cheddar cheese – Sharp cheddar gives the best punch
  • 1/4 cup diced ham – About the size of small peas works perfectly
  • 1/4 cup melted butter – Real butter only, please!
  • 1 large egg – Room temperature blends best
  • 1 tsp baking powder – The lift-maker
  • 1/4 tsp salt – Just enough to enhance flavors
  • 1/4 tsp black pepper – Adds a nice little kick

That’s it! Simple, wholesome ingredients that come together beautifully.

How to Make Ham and Cheese Almond Flour Breakfast Biscuits (Keto)

Okay, let’s get baking! These biscuits come together so fast you’ll be shocked. Here’s exactly how I do it – with all my little tricks for perfect results every time:

First, fire up that oven to 350°F (175°C). While it’s heating, grab a big mixing bowl and whisk together your dry ingredients – that’s the almond flour, baking powder, salt, and pepper. I like to sift mine through a fine mesh strainer to avoid any lumps (almond flour can be sneaky like that).

Now for the fun part – add your melted butter (let it cool slightly so it doesn’t cook the egg!), the egg, cheese, and ham. Stir gently with a wooden spoon just until everything comes together. Don’t overmix! The dough should be thick and slightly sticky – that’s perfect.

Scoop time! I use a cookie scoop (about 2 tablespoons) to portion the dough onto a parchment-lined baking sheet. Gently pat them into biscuit shapes – they won’t spread much, so no need to space them far apart. Pro tip: Wet your fingers slightly to prevent sticking while shaping.

Into the oven they go for 15-18 minutes. You’ll know they’re done when the edges turn that beautiful golden brown and your kitchen smells like heaven. Let them cool on the pan for 5 minutes – they firm up as they cool. Then dig in while they’re still warm and melty!

Tips for Perfect Ham and Cheese Almond Flour Breakfast Biscuits (Keto)

Listen, I’ve made these biscuits more times than I can count, and here are my foolproof secrets:

  • Parchment is your friend: No sticking, no scrubbing pans—just slide those beauties right off.
  • Mix with care: Stir just until combined—overmixing makes them tough (we want tender, not hockey pucks!).
  • Crispness control: Like them extra golden? Add 2 extra minutes—but watch closely, almond flour browns fast!
  • Size matters: Keep biscuits uniform so they bake evenly—that scoop I mentioned? Lifesaver.

Oh, and pro tip: Let them cool slightly before eating—that cheese gets lava-hot!

Variations for Ham and Cheese Almond Flour Breakfast Biscuits (Keto)

These biscuits are crazy versatile—here’s how I switch them up when I’m feeling adventurous:

  • Bacon lovers: Swap the ham for crispy crumbled bacon (about 1/3 cup)—it adds that smoky punch I crave.
  • Cheese shuffle: Try pepper jack for spice or Swiss for a milder twist. Even feta works for a tangy surprise!
  • Herb it up: A teaspoon of dried rosemary or thyme makes them fancy enough for brunch guests.

The beauty? You can’t mess them up—just keep the core ratios the same and play!

Storage and Reheating Instructions

These biscuits keep like a dream! Store them in an airtight container at room temp for 2 days or in the fridge for up to 4 days. Want that fresh-from-the-oven magic? Just pop them in the toaster for 2-3 minutes or warm in a 300°F oven for 5 minutes—crispy outside, melty inside, just like day one. (Freezer tip: They freeze beautifully for up to 3 months in a ziplock—no thawing needed, just reheat straight from frozen!)

Frequently Asked Questions

Q1. Can I freeze these keto ham and cheese biscuits?
Absolutely! These freeze like a dream. Just cool them completely, then store in a freezer bag for up to 3 months. When that biscuit craving hits, pop them straight into the toaster – no thawing needed!

Q2. Is almond flour really necessary, or can I substitute coconut flour?
Oh honey, don’t try coconut flour here – they’re totally different beasts! Almond flour gives these biscuits their perfect texture. If you must substitute, try half sunflower seed flour (but your biscuits might turn green – harmless but weird looking!).

Q3. My dough seems too wet/sticky – what did I do wrong?
No worries! Almond flour varies by brand. If it’s sticky, just add a tablespoon more almond flour until it holds its shape. Too dry? A teaspoon of water at a time until it comes together. Baking’s all about feel!

Q4. Can I make these dairy-free?
You bet! Swap the butter for coconut oil and use dairy-free cheese (Violife cheddar-style works great). The texture changes slightly, but they’re still delicious!

Q5. Why didn’t my biscuits rise much?
Two likely culprits: Old baking powder (test it in hot water – it should bubble!) or overmixing. Remember – gentle folds, not vigorous beating. They won’t puff like wheat flour biscuits, but should have a nice tender crumb.
